BEDRIACUM (ITALY) 2009

In 2009, under the auspices of the University of Milan and guided by the late Prof. Maria Teresa Grassi, I had the unique opportunity to participate in archaeological fieldwork in Calvatone (Bedriacum). POPULONIA (ITALY) 2008

In 2008, I was privileged to engage in archaeological fieldwork in the Archaeological Park of Baratti and Populonia, Italy, as part of a team from the University of Milan (Università Statale di Milano).  This project, focused on the excavation of the proto-Villanovan and Villanovan necropolis, was conducted under the brilliant supervision of Prof. Giorgio Baratti.
